Dr. Greg Harrell is a globally recognized authority on industrial energy systems, with a career dedicated to driving sustainable improvement in energy efficiency. Beginning as a Utilities Process Engineer at a major cogeneration facility, he has since built an illustrious career centered on evaluating and optimizing industrial energy systems.

With a doctorate in applied thermodynamics and over 18 years of hands-on experience, Dr. Harrell has conducted energy assessments and training programs in 26 countries across six continents, as well as in 38 U.S. states. His expertise spans steam systems, combined heat and power (cogeneration), compressed air systems, and process heating systems.

As a Lead Technical Advisor for the United States Department of Energy Industrial Program, Dr. Harrell has played a pivotal role in developing influential resources, including the USDOE BestPractices Steam Tools, the Steam System Survey Guide, and training programs like the USDOE Steam Specialist Qualification Training.

Dr. Harrell is also a distinguished educator, serving as Milligan University’s Director of Engineering Programs and a Professor of Mechanical Engineering. He also was the primary instructor for the North Carolina State University Energy Management Diploma Program and the University of North Carolina Charlotte Continuing Education Program.
